I'm not sure the Info Center has been updated in a long time.
Sounds like your installation is *not* getting updated properly. As of two days ago, the Skyshrine graphic was replaced with the new Qeynos Rises graphic. The fact that Skyshrine graphic is off-center tells me that you haven't gotten updated since Skyshrine went live, since that screen was fixed to center correctly. The first thing to do is make sure the Updater actually points to the EQII setup your are running now. Open the Updater, then select Settings->File Paths. Make sure the path is correct. Look at the Properties for the shortcut you use to launch EQII and make sure the Updater points to the same place. |

The graphic is done in eq2ui_loginscene.xml (located in UI/ProfitUI under the game folder), if the alignment of the logos and text is off that's the culprit. The current one is dated 4/17/2012. If yours is older than that, it hasn't been updated. One brute-force method, if the file isn't current but the updater says it is or if it's current and the problem still occurs, is to run a search for the filename on your hard drive and see if more than one occurrence turns up. If there's multiple game installations hanging around, sometimes that's the simplest way to find them. There should only be 2 occurrences of eq2ui_loginscene.xml, both under the EQ2 game folder: the one in UI/Default, and the one in UI/ProfitUI.

Quote:
1. Updater was originally installed into an earlier version of Java, when a later version tries to run it it fails. Common when Java's auto-updated itself. Clear it and reinstall it through the latest Java, and do manual updates of Java. 2. Updater was installed from Chrome, the installation is corrupted. Clear it if needed and reinstall using Firefox or IE. The "clear it through javaws and then reinstall" has always cleared it up for me. Beyond that, I'm stumped. The updater isn't something I'm familiar with, and lately it's been increasingly twitchy. |
